摘  要:According to the morphological characteristics of crushed stone,the sphericity was introduced to establish the theoretical calculation model of volume fraction of interfacial transition zone(ITZ)around crushed stone.The sphericity of crushed stone was obtained by image processing technology and numerical statistics.The experimental results show that when the maximum particle size of coarse aggregate is less than 31.5 mm,the practical sphericity is generally around 0.75,while the sphericity of sand is generally above 0.85.And the closer to 1 the practical sphericity is,the smaller the ITZ volume fraction(V_(ITZ))is,that is,the closer to spherical shape the aggregate is,the lower the ITZ content in concrete is.The V_(ITZ) and ITZ thickness in concrete and mortar have a linear relationship,and the ITZ content in concrete is lower than that in mortar at the same aggregate volume fraction.
